About azanylidyneoxidanium;carbon monoxide;ethyl 2-[(1S,6S)-4-methoxy-6-methylcyclohexa-2,4-dien-1-yl]-3-oxobutanoate;manganese

azanylidyneoxidanium;carbon monoxide;ethyl 2-[(1S,6S)-4-methoxy-6-methylcyclohexa-2,4-dien-1-yl]-3-oxobutanoate;manganese (PubChem CID 134886936) has the molecular formula C16H20MnNO7+ and a molecular weight of 393.27 g/mol. Its IUPAC name is azanylidyneoxidanium;carbon monoxide;ethyl 2-[(1S,6S)-4-methoxy-6-methylcyclohexa-2,4-dien-1-yl]-3-oxobutanoate;manganese.
